Bank robbery bid in Mawthawpdah

Mawkyrwat, June 7:  In a daring bank heist, unidentified robbers on Monday tried to rob the Meghalaya Rural Bank (MRB), Mawthawpdah Branch in South West Khasi Hills District but in vain after they could not enter the strong room where the safe is located.

Speaking to the Sentinel, Branch Mager of MRB Mawthawpdah Branch, James R Pala, said that the incident took place on Sunday night before dawn in which unidentified robbers tried to rob the bank by cutting the lock and enters the office but they could not get any money because they cannot enter the strong room where the safe is located.

"The robbers cut two locks and enter the office but they could not enter the strong room where the safe was located and therefore they could not steal any money. However, 21 ATM cards have been missing," Pala said, adding an FIR has been filed today at the Mawkyrwat police station.

Meanwhile, the Mawkyrwat police informed that investigation into the incident is going on.
